1

jQueryToolsEXPOSE関数を使用しようとしています。オーバーレイツールとそのAPIオブジェクトを正常に実装しました(したがって、api.close()を呼び出すことができます)。初期化行に問題があり、適切なオブジェクトがAPI変数に渡されていないと思います。コメントで以下のエラーを確認できます。

http://cdn.jquerytools.org/1.2.3/full/jquery.tools.min.js

var api;  
function exposeItem(v){

    api=$('#'+v).expose({
        api: true,
        color:'#000',
        loadSpeed:'fast',
        closeSpeed:'fast' 
    });

    api.load();  


    api.close(); 
    //Object #<an Object> has no method 'close'
 }

この件に関してご協力いただければ幸いです。

4

1 に答える 1

3

私は答えを見つけました。それはとても単純で、理解するのに丸一日しかかかりませんでした。

//api.close();
$.mask.close();
于 2010-06-24T14:20:31.743 に答える